The U.S. conversational AI landscape is segmented across multiple high-impact sectors, each demonstrating unique growth drivers, technological adoption rates, and strategic investment patterns. The primary application segments include customer service, healthcare, banking and finance, retail, and enterprise automation. These segments are characterized by varying maturity levels, with customer service leading due to widespread adoption of chatbots and virtual assistants to enhance customer engagement and reduce operational costs. Healthcare applications are rapidly expanding, driven by telemedicine trends and the need for personalized patient interactions. Banking and finance leverage conversational AI for fraud detection, customer onboarding, and personalized financial advice, reflecting a shift towards digital-first banking experiences. Retail sectors utilize AI-driven chatbots for personalized shopping assistance, order tracking, and post-sale support, fostering customer loyalty and operational efficiency. Enterprise automation employs conversational AI to streamline internal workflows, HR functions, and IT support, emphasizing productivity gains. Overall, these applications are converging towards integrated, multi-channel platforms that deliver seamless, real-time interactions, positioning conversational AI as a critical enabler of digital transformation across industries in the U.S.

The competitive landscape is characterized by a mix of global technology giants, regional challengers, and innovative startups. Leading firms such as Google, Microsoft, and Amazon dominate with extensive product portfolios, deep R&D investments, and integrated cloud platforms. These players leverage their vast data ecosystems and AI expertise to maintain market leadership, with revenue growth averaging 15-20% annually over the past five years. Regional challengers like Nuance Communications and IBM focus on industry-specific solutions, particularly healthcare and finance, with tailored offerings and strategic partnerships. Disruptive startups such as Ada and Kore.ai are gaining traction through agile deployment models, low-cost solutions, and rapid innovation cycles. M&A activity remains vigorous, with recent acquisitions aimed at expanding AI capabilities, vertical integration, and entering new verticals. Innovation intensity is high, with R&D expenditure typically accounting for 10-15% of revenue, emphasizing continuous advancement in NLP, speech recognition, and contextual understanding. The competitive environment favors firms with strong intellectual property, customer-centric innovation, and strategic regional presence.
